原文:聊一聊高并发高可用那些事 - Kafka篇

目录 为什么需要消息队列 .异步 :一个下单流程,你需要扣积分,扣优惠卷,发短信等,有些耗时又不需要立即处理的事,可以丢到队列里异步处理。 .削峰 :按平常的流量,服务器刚好可以正常负载。偶尔推出一个优惠活动时,请求量极速上升。由于服务器 Redis,MySQL 承受能力不一样,如果请求全部接收,服务器负载不了会导致宕机。加机器嘛,需要去调整配置,活动结束后用不到了,即麻烦又浪费。这时可以将请求 ...

2020-06-07 23:01 0 543 推荐指数:

查看详情

PV和并发

  最近和几个朋友,聊到并发和服务器的压力问题。很多朋友,不知道该怎么去计算并发?部署多少台服务器才合适? 所以,今天就来PV和并发,还有计算web服务器的数量 的等方法。这些都是自己的想法加上一些网上的总结,如有不对,欢迎拍砖。    几个概念     网站流量是指网站的访问量 ...

Tue Aug 16 16:34:00 CST 2016 11 6788
数据导出那些

前言 数据导出,这可以说是一个随处可见的需求,大部分管理平台,报表系统都会有这个需求。 对于这个需求,不少系统会做限制,只能从系统导出几千或几万的数据,再多的话就要提申请,经过层层审批,到 DB ...

Mon Apr 12 16:10:00 CST 2021 0 483
Iterable与Iterator的那些

前言 欢迎关注公众号:Coder编程 获取最新原创技术文章和相关免费学习资料,随时随地学习技术知识! 在上一文章通过面试题,让我们来了解Collection,我们会发现Collection接口之上还有一个接口Iterable, Iterable接口里面又有Iterator接口 ...

Tue Mar 26 05:22:00 CST 2019 0 568
SpringCloud可用并发

1 可用 什么是可用:(High Availability)在一个长时间内服务不受影响。通俗的讲就是,一个机器挂掉的时候,有其他机器可以继续提供同样的服务。 如何实现可用:冗余+自动故障转移。冗余即提供备份服务器,自动故障转移即当一个服务挂掉的时候,检测机制可以检查到,会实施自动的故障 ...

Mon Apr 08 02:55:00 CST 2019 0 1267
可用并发浅析

概念解析: 可用HA(High Availability)是分布式系统架构中必须考虑的因素之一,它通常是指,通过设计减少系统不能提供服务的时间。假设系统一直能够提供服务,那么该系统的可用性是100%。如果系统每运行100个时间单位,会有1个时间单位无法提供服务,那么该系统的可用性是99 ...

Fri May 19 19:09:00 CST 2017 0 4301
并发可用总结

并发系统架构常用案例 通用场景 日用户流量大,但是比较分散,偶尔会有用户聚的情况; 解决思路 通过服务器架构和代码分流,系统架构设计保证它能够同时并行处理很多请求 场景特征 并发相关常用的一些指标有响应时间(Response Time),吞吐量(Throughput),每秒查询率 ...

Fri Jun 19 04:34:00 CST 2020 0 590
kafka可用探究

kafka可用探究 众所周知 kafka 的 topic 可以使用 --replication-factor 数和 partitions 数来保证服务的可用性 问题发现 但在最近的运维过程中,3台集群的kafka,副本与分区都为3,有其中一台 broker 挂了导致整个集群成了 ...

Wed Sep 29 23:37:00 CST 2021 0 276
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M